What has been the stand out theme common to all your weddings and clients this year?

Outdoor ceremonies have been the request this year. And given our inclement summer weather, it was a miracle that I managed to give all couples their outdoor ceremonies!

Outdoor ceremonies are wonderful for rustic/vintage/earthy weddings. If you would like an outdoor ceremony it’s important to have a contingency plan in place in case you have to move it indoors. I remember one wedding where I spent the morning counting clouds!

What’s been the most beautiful / ‘wow’ wedding thing you’ve seen this year at a wedding?

I planned a coastal outdoor ceremony for a sweet American couple on a cliff in the fishing village of Howth, Co Dublin. The backdrop of sweet heather, blue sea and sky, seagulls and sheer cliff rock was simply breathtaking.
